Before you put hour house on the market, consider installing some energy-saving elements that will appeal to purchasers. If you install energy star rated items, such as energy monitors, LED bulbs, and solar motion lights outdoors, people may be more likely to buy the house because they can save a great deal of money not having to buy those things themselves.

Asking Price

Ask a reasonable price for your home. Do some research to find similar homes for sale in your area. A reasonable asking price will usually be around the average asking price of these homes. By overpricing your home from the outset, you are only going to have to reduce it eventually.

Pack away and remove clutter and excess furniture while your home is on the market, whether you still live there or not. A potential buyer should be able picture themselves in your home. Cleaning things out will make this easier on them, and on you, as you prepare for your moving day.

Have your heating and air conditioning serviced before putting your home on the market to make sure everything is in good working order. Because these units can be very pricy, they are one of the first things that most buyers will ask about.

When selling your home, you need to act in part as an information hub. Someone will always want answers about something. From people who have worked on your home to various aspects of the neighborhood, make sure you know a lot about the home before you attempt to sell it. Buyers are risking a lot of money on even a modest home, so they definitely want their questions answered. If you can answer them and put them at ease, you have a better chance of selling your property.

The market for housing is season driven in many areas in the country. If this is true in your region, seasonally-themed decorations can make your house attractive to prospective buyers. Rake your leaves if you’re selling your home in late autumn.

If you need to paint your house before showing it, don’t choose a color simply because you favor it. Rather, select neutral and appealing shades such as white, cream, or light beige. New paint can effectively show off your home to potential buyers.
